About A. Rubenstrunk

A. Rubenstrunk is a scholar working on Molecular Biology, General Health Professions, Epidemiology, Neurology and Endocrinology, Diabetes and Metabolism, having authored 8 papers that have together received 643 indexed citations. Recurring topics across this work include Healthcare Systems and Practices (2 papers), Health, Medicine and Society (2 papers), Peroxisome Proliferator-Activated Receptors (1 paper), Microbial Inactivation Methods (1 paper), Viral Infectious Diseases and Gene Expression in Insects (1 paper), Amyotrophic Lateral Sclerosis Research (1 paper), Chronic Disease Management Strategies (1 paper) and Nutrition and Health in Aging (1 paper). The work is most often cited by research in Hepatology (97 citations), Epidemiology (293 citations), Endocrinology, Diabetes and Metabolism (141 citations), Biochemistry (50 citations) and Molecular Biology (307 citations). A. Rubenstrunk has collaborated with scholars based in France and Belgium. Frequent co-authors include Bart Staels, Rémy Hanf, Dean W. Hum, J.C. Fruchart, Benoît Noël, Anne Tailleux, Lesley J. Millatt, Philippe Delataille, Anthony Lucas and Morgane Baron. Their work appears in journals such as The Journal of Gene Medicine, Biochimica et Biophysica Acta (BBA) - Molecular and Cell Biology of Lipids, Hepatology, Cell Biology and Toxicology and Revue Neurologique.
